Biometric Security: Elevating Home Protection in the Modern Era

In the digital age, where technology permeates every aspect of our lives, the concept of home security has undergone a remarkable transformation. Traditional methods, such as locks and keys, have been augmented by sophisticated biometric security systems that offer unprecedented levels of protection and convenience. Biometric security, which utilizes unique physical or behavioural characteristics for authentication, has emerged as a cutting-edge solution for safeguarding modern homes. Let’s explore the role of biometric security in modern homes and the benefits it brings to homeowners:

1. Enhanced Access Control: Biometric security systems provide robust access control mechanisms that significantly enhance home security. By using unique biometric identifiers, such as fingerprints, facial recognition, or iris scans, homeowners can restrict access to their properties and ensure that only authorized individuals are granted entry. This eliminates the need for keys, which can be lost, stolen, or duplicated, and mitigates the risk of unauthorized access or intrusions.

2. Convenience and Ease of Use: Biometric security systems offer unparalleled convenience and ease of use compared to traditional security methods. With biometric authentication, homeowners can quickly and effortlessly access their homes without fumbling for keys or memorizing complex passwords. The seamless integration of biometric technology into everyday devices, such as smart door locks and security systems, streamlines the authentication process and enhances the overall user experience.

3. Stronger Authentication: Biometric identifiers, such as fingerprints or facial features, are inherently unique to each individual and difficult to replicate or spoof. Unlike passwords or PINs, which can be forgotten, stolen, or shared, biometric characteristics provide a more reliable and secure method of authentication. This significantly reduces the risk of unauthorized access or identity theft and strengthens the overall security posture of modern homes.

4. Customizable Security Levels: Biometric security systems offer customizable security levels that can be tailored to suit the specific needs and preferences of homeowners. Advanced biometric solutions allow homeowners to configure access permissions for different individuals, set time-based restrictions, and monitor access logs in real-time. This granular level of control empowers homeowners to effectively manage security risks and adapt their security protocols as needed.

5. Integration with Smart Home Technology: Biometric security seamlessly integrates with smart home technology, creating a cohesive ecosystem that enhances home automation and security. Biometric authentication can be integrated with smart door locks, security cameras, lighting systems, and other connected devices to create a comprehensive security infrastructure. This integration enables homeowners to remotely monitor and control their security systems, receive real-time alerts, and respond to security incidents from anywhere in the world.

6. Privacy and Data Protection: Biometric security systems prioritize privacy and data protection by storing biometric data in encrypted formats and implementing robust security measures to prevent unauthorized access or misuse. Unlike traditional authentication methods that rely on centralized databases or servers, many biometric systems utilize local authentication processes, reducing the risk of data breaches or privacy violations.
